Download.it ikona szukania
Advertisement

Darmowy program do tworzenia aplikacji dla komputerów osobistych

Darmowy program do tworzenia aplikacji dla komputerów osobistych

Zagłosuj: (Głosy: 2)

Program licencji: Darmowa

Twórca programu: Microsoft

Wersja: 9.0.30729

Działa pod: Windows

Zagłosuj:

Program licencji

(Głosy: 2)

Darmowa

Twórca programu

Wersja

Microsoft

9.0.30729

Działa pod:

Windows

Zalety

  • Dojrzałe, wspierane zintegrowane środowisko programistyczne
  • Darmowe i dystrybuowane
  • Łatwe do zainstalowania
  • Krótka krzywa uczenia się
  • Wbudowane narzędzia zwiększające produktywność
  • Natywne połączenia z bazami danych
  • Wbudowany edytor HTML
  • Nowoczesny, prosty interfejs użytkownika
  • Dynamiczna pomoc
  • Zaawansowane debugowanie
  • Monitorowanie stanu w czasie rzeczywistym
  • Uniwersalny edytor kodu

Wady

  • Duży rozmiar pliku do pobrania
  • Wymaga rejestracji w firmie Microsoft, aby korzystać z niego dłużej niż 30 dni
  • Ograniczone wsparcie klienta

Podobnie jak w przypadku wcześniejszych wydań, Microsoft udostępnił ekspresową wersję swojego flagowego zintegrowanego środowiska programistycznego "Visual Studio 2008" zarówno dla początkujących, jak i profesjonalnych programistów C#. Ponieważ większość rzeczywistych profesjonalnych aplikacji ma dostęp do relacyjnych baz danych, C# 2008 Express Edition jest w pełni kompatybilny z Microsoft SQL Server Express.

Microsoft Visual Studio działa natywnie z .NET w wersji 3.5, ale umożliwia budowanie, rozwijanie i utrzymywanie aplikacji dla .NET 2.0 i .NET 3.0. Aby to osiągnąć, programiści mogą używać C# 2008 Express Edition lub dowolnego z języków .NET dołączonych do Visual Studio Express 2008. Dzięki C# 2008 Express użytkownicy mogą tworzyć aplikacje Windows Development Foundation (WPF), Windows Communication Foundation (WCF), Windows Workflow (WF) lub Language Integrated Query (LINQ).

Wsparcie programistyczne dla Microsoft C# 2008 Express Edition przewyższa to dostępne w nowszych wydaniach C#, co czyni go idealnym dla początkujących. Różnorodne książki, samouczki, triki i wskazówki szybko przygotowują początkujących do wykonywania zaawansowanych zadań zawodowych, na które jest duże zapotrzebowanie wśród współczesnych pracodawców.

W szczególności C# 2008 Express Edition pozwala programistom pisać zapytania do baz danych, manipulować danymi, korzystać z zestawów danych i adapterów danych, używać XML i budować aplikacje ASP.NET. W wielu przypadkach C# 2008 obsługuje te i inne procedury poprzez swoją wbudowaną funkcjonalność.

Po wyjęciu z pudełka, C# 2008 Express Edition prezentuje nowoczesny interfejs, który wykorzystuje system dokumentów z zakładkami dla ekranów kodu i układu. Ponadto C# 2008 Express wykorzystuje dokowane paski narzędzi i okna informacyjne, aby utrzymać przestrzeń roboczą w czystości i bez bałaganu. W przeciwieństwie do narzędzi Visual Studio z lat 90., potężne funkcje tego IDE dają programistom możliwość tworzenia interfejsów użytkownika WYSIWYG, które oszczędzają czas projektowania.

Weterani kodowania docenią również automatyczne uzupełnianie kodu, IntelliSense, oznaczanie błędów składni oraz dynamiczną pomoc kontekstową dostępną w C# 2008 Express Edition. Uzupełnianie kodu, automatyczne podpowiedzi dla każdej metody i pomocna dokumentacja zwiększają produktywność na wiele sposobów. Podobnie, dostęp do pełnej biblioteki SDK z poziomu IDE pozwala nawet początkującym programistom na bieżąco odpowiadać na własne pytania. Wszystkie języki .NET korzystają teraz z tego samego edytora kodu. Filozoficznie, specjalistyczne aspekty każdego języka nie powinny podważać wspólnych funkcji, takich jak obrys kodu, numeracja linii, kodowanie kolorami i wyszukiwanie przyrostowe. Połączenie ich w jednym edytorze kodu oznacza krótszą krzywą uczenia się i szybkie przejście na nowe platformy.

Aby jeszcze bardziej zwiększyć wydajność, IDE zawiera stronę startową, która ułatwia dostęp do nowych i istniejących projektów. Podobnie, Solution Explorer i zintegrowany debugger w C# 2008 pozwalają programiście zobaczyć wszystkie pliki w formie konspektu, przejść przez projekt kodu i interaktywnie obserwować przebieg pracy w wielu językach i procesach.

Zalet

Zalety

  • Dojrzałe, wspierane zintegrowane środowisko programistyczne
  • Darmowe i dystrybuowane
  • Łatwe do zainstalowania
  • Krótka krzywa uczenia się
  • Wbudowane narzędzia zwiększające produktywność
  • Natywne połączenia z bazami danych
  • Wbudowany edytor HTML
  • Nowoczesny, prosty interfejs użytkownika
  • Dynamiczna pomoc
  • Zaawansowane debugowanie
  • Monitorowanie stanu w czasie rzeczywistym
  • Uniwersalny edytor kodu

Wady

  • Duży rozmiar pliku do pobrania
  • Wymaga rejestracji w firmie Microsoft, aby korzystać z niego dłużej niż 30 dni
  • Ograniczone wsparcie klienta